WebApr 24, 2024 · Life changing events are significant personal events that may impact your health insurance, life insurance or other federal benefits. Often, you should notify your … WebSep 21, 2024 · Your Qualifying Life Event (QLE) immediately begins a Special Enrollment Period (SEP) once it occurs. When you enter that Special Enrollment Period, you or your family can pick a new comprehensive health plan without penalty. WebQualifying life events trigger a "special enrollment period" that typically lasts 30 to 60 days, depending on your plan, during which you can select a new plan or add a new dependent to your plan. To change your plan selections, notify your current or future health plan sponsor of the qualifying event in your life as soon as possible.
